A tooth filling is truly what it sounds like: a way to fill the hole a cavity leaves behind. Cavities start when bacteria eat through your enamel. This decay doesn’t stop on its own.

Not every filling is the same. Your choice depends on the cavity’s location, your budget, and personal preference. The right dentist will explain each option so you feel good about your decision.
Here are the most common types:
Tooth-colored and blend in with your smile. Great for front teeth and visible areas.
Silver-colored and very strong. Often used for back teeth that handle a lot of pressure.
Made from porcelain. Durable and natural-looking, but can cost more.
Release fluoride over time. Ideal for small cavities or areas near the gums.

If you’ve never had a filling, the unknown can feel worse than the cavity itself. But most patients are surprised by how easy the process is.
Here’s what happens step-by-step:
Your dentist applies a local anesthetic. You won’t feel pain, just light pressure.
The damaged part of the tooth is cleaned out. The goal is to leave a healthy structure behind.
Your dentist shapes the filling to properly match your bite, then bonds it in place.
The filling is smoothed and tested to make sure everything feels natural.
The whole thing often takes under an hour. You’ll walk out the door ready to chew on the other side and in a day or so, fully back to normal.
